Industrial Medium Voltage Cables Market: Overview and Growth Drivers
The Industrial Medium Voltage Cables Market plays a vital role in the energy infrastructure, providing essential connections between power generation sources, substations, and industrial facilities. Medium voltage (MV) cables, typically operating between 1 kV and 35 kV, are widely used in sectors such as manufacturing, oil and gas, renewable energy, transportation, and utilities. The increasing demand for electricity, combined with the need for robust and efficient power transmission, has positioned MV cables as critical components in industrial operations.

Market Segmentation
1. By Type
- Underground Cables: Widely used in urban areas to minimize the visual impact of power infrastructure and reduce the risk of electrical faults.
- Overhead Cables: Commonly deployed in rural and remote areas due to lower installation costs and easier maintenance.
- Submarine Cables: Used in offshore energy projects, particularly for transmitting electricity from offshore wind farms and oil platforms to mainland grids.
2. By Material
- Copper Cables: Highly conductive and reliable, copper cables are preferred for industrial applications that demand high efficiency and durability.
- Aluminum Cables: Lighter and more cost-effective than copper, aluminum is increasingly used in large-scale industrial installations, especially where weight and budget are concerns.
3. By End-User
- Utilities: Power generation and transmission companies are among the largest consumers of medium voltage cables, using them for grid infrastructure and substations.
- Manufacturing: Industrial facilities require MV cables for internal power distribution to operate machinery and maintain electrical safety standards.
- Oil & Gas: Refineries and offshore platforms rely on these cables to ensure the smooth operation of critical equipment in hazardous environments.
- Renewable Energy: Solar farms, wind farms, and hydropower facilities depend on medium voltage cables to connect energy production units to the grid.

Challenges and Opportunities
1. Price Volatility of Raw Materials
The cost of raw materials such as copper and aluminum can significantly affect the pricing of medium voltage cables. Fluctuations in commodity prices pose challenges for manufacturers, impacting profit margins and leading to potential project delays.
2. Technological Advancements
The growing adoption of advanced technologies such as smart grids, digital substations, and grid automation is driving innovation in medium voltage cables. Manufacturers are focusing on developing cables with enhanced conductivity, durability, and energy efficiency to meet the evolving needs of these advanced energy systems.
3. Regulatory and Environmental Concerns
Governments and regulatory bodies are implementing stringent standards regarding the environmental impact and safety of industrial cables. Manufacturers are increasingly focusing on the development of eco-friendly, recyclable materials, and fire-resistant cables to comply with these regulations.
